EM 2021: national team beats Portugal

The German national team can breathe a sigh of relief after beating Portugal 4-2. With a clear increase in performance compared to the 1-0 defeat against France, the DFB team clinched their first tournament victory and underlined their role as co-favorites. All votes for the game:

Joachim Löw (national coach):

… about the game: “All in all, it was a great achievement: great attitude, great morale. We were right to win at heights and created a lot of chances. A great performance. From the start there was speed in the actions, including the outside positions. Our plan is good The things that we didn’t do so well against France, we did well, that was to be expected.

… about Robin Gosens: The 4-0 was of course a great cross and an incredible header from Gosens. He may still have the game of his life ahead of him.

… about his emotions: A game like this is always a nerve battle, even for a coach. It goes up and down. “



Robin Gosens: “It feels unreal, an unbelievable evening on all levels for me. You couldn’t ask for more. I felt well integrated from the start, today. At the end of the day: world class! That was passionate, a huge game of We threw everything in. There was real pressure on the boiler. If we hadn’t taken the three points with us, it would look different. We pushed each other, sometimes for a defensive tackle.

Kai Havertz: “We can be satisfied with the performance. We played it well. It was important not to throw everything upside down after the France game, but to stay true to ourselves. We trust the system and we trust the players. Hungary will be a tough opponent who should not be underestimated, very strong defensively. That will be tough again. “



Thomas Müller: “It’s just fun in this mood. The kettle boils there. We had a lot of good aspects, but also a lot of things that we still have to improve. That can cost points in the end. Now we have the three points, now we’re good at it Tournament and we have it in our own hands. Now we mustn’t overdo it or become arrogant – but we can believe in our quality. We can feel a little euphoria. “

Michael Ballack (on “MagentaTV”): “A great victory, well deserved at altitude. You kept the pressure up for 65, 70 minutes – that was a scent mark. Offensive it was almost too easy to be true.”

Bastian Schweinsteiger (on “ARD”): “Not only the three points, but also the manner were great. Robin Gosens played a very, very good game, a dream came true for him. Joshua Kimmich and Thomas Müller were also outstanding.”

Fernando Santos (Nationaltrainer Portugal): “It’s my responsibility. I wanted to play like that. We already had an advantage in midfield, but the Germans managed to break free from difficult situations again and again. On the whole, my players tried everything. But against Germany It’s just difficult to play. They only committed two fouls in the first half. We had problems with possession. Germany were the better team. I’ll take responsibility. “

João Moutinho: “It’s a result that we didn’t want. Sometimes we couldn’t defend ourselves against Germany’s superiority, but we have to take the positive things from this game. Germany have a great team, many good players who played between the lines We couldn’t get rid of the pressure, but then we did better. We made it 2-4 and had another shot from the post. But we have to keep working. “

Renato Sanches: “We still had scoring chances, just like them. It was a game between two great teams. The result speaks for itself, but I think we had a chance to take it back.”
